They begin dating quickly and seem perfectly happy together. Like her mother, she is beautiful, charismatic and a popular student. Like her father, she is intelligent and bright.

She also inherited his love for in-fight bantering. In addition, she is a very good athlete and excelled in her girls' basketball team until she quit after her powers emerged. On the other hand, May seems to have inherited the "Parker luck" in which her dual identity wreaks havoc in her private life. May promised to give up costumed super heroics, dated Gene Thompson , and ran for student council president. When Mary Jane became aware that the Hobgoblin posed a threat to her daughter's teenage friends, she allowed Mayday to resume her activities as Spider-Girl a situation they wanted to keep secret from Peter.

After a battle with the Hobgoblin, May told her father the truth, and after a conversation with Mary Jane, they allowed May to resume her Spider-Girl identity. After an attempt at helping the S. It attached itself to May's friend Moose , who became the new Carnage.

In exchange, Carnage would bond itself to Moose's terminally ill father , curing him in the process. Carnage caused a stir at May's school and kidnapped Peter and Baby Ben , forcing May to confront her friend. May tried to talk to Moose within the symbiote but failed, and it bonded with her brother Ben.

Peter escaped as May battled the two symbiotes and gathered sonic gear that might have been able to defeat the symbiote. However it was May who used the weapons, thereby destroying the piece of the Carnage symbiote. Her success was not without a measure of collateral damage as well, however; not only was Moose furious at Spider-Girl for dooming his father, but the sonic weapon rendered Ben deaf, possibly permanently.

Ben's hearing was eventually restored thanks to the intervention of Normie Osborn.
